We give Abound cat food a rating of 3.5 out of 5 stars.

Abound cat food is sold under the Kroger brand, which provides pet store quality food at grocery store prices. The brand is touted as a filler-free food, and it doesn’t contain any corn, soy, or wheat. The Abound brand was launched in 2014 and has since become a popular cat food for Kroger customers around the country who prefer to feed natural food to their felines.

    Abound Cat Food Reviewed

    Abound cat food features real meat as the first ingredient, but the formulas also include plant proteins like legumes and carbohydrates like brown rice that cats wouldn’t eat in the wild. So, it might be natural in the sense of what is in the ingredients list, but it isn’t natural in the sense of what a cat needs, which is a strictly carnivorous diet.

    However, Abound is nutritionally complete due to the addition of synthetic vitamins, minerals, and antioxidants. Cats can do well on this food, especially if their diets are supplemented with real meat snacks. It’s an affordable, middle-of-the-line cat food that doesn’t contain any artificial ingredients or animal by-products like the lower quality and sometimes even more expensive brands do.

    Where Is Abound Cat Food Produced?

    Abound cat food is produced in the United States, but it isn’t clear where its ingredients are sourced. Because the company hasn’t clarified, we assume that ingredients are sourced from different places around the world, which is a bit worrisome, as many countries don’t have the same safety standards as the United States.

    Primary Ingredients (Good and Bad)

    The primary ingredient used in all Abound cat food products is animal meat. Chicken, turkey, beef, and salmon are the most common meats in dry and wet cat foods. The company doesn’t specify whether any meats they use are farm-raised, wild, or free-range. Other ingredients commonly found in the Abound cat food line’s ingredient list include the following.

    Brown Rice

    Brown rice is included in Abound’s grain-free formulas. While brown rice is healthier than white and is an excellent energy source for humans, this isn’t the case for cats. They don’t need plant-based carbohydrates at all to stay healthy. However, most cats can do well on a diet with plant carbohydrates added, as long as the carbs aren’t the main ingredients.

    Sweet Potatoes

    Sweet potatoes are another ingredient found in many of the Abound cat food recipes. Like brown rice, it isn’t necessarily bad for cats, but it isn’t what they would eat in their natural habitat. Still, it provides extra nutrition in the form of vitamins and minerals. It also provides energy to keep cats active throughout the day.

    Recall History

    The Abound brand of cat food was recalled one time in late 2018 due to the potential for elevated levels of vitamin D. The recall only applied to some dry food recipes in the brand’s line, but no further recalls have occurred since.

    3. Abound Salmon and Sweet Potato, Chicken and Beef, and Turkey Stew Wet Cat Food

    Abound Variety Pack Wet Cat Food

    Abound’s wet cat food line includes a variety of exciting recipes that cats find hard to resist. Each formula is made with real shredded meat and seafood broth for a rich flavor that ensures that no cat will leave a bite behind. However, the brand’s wet food doesn’t contain whole-food vitamins and minerals aside from the meat and a couple of vegetables in the stew recipes.

    Instead, synthetic vitamins, minerals, and amino acids are included to ensure the formula is nutritionally complete for cats of all ages. Unfortunately, the foods are thickened with ingredients not nutritionally necessary for cats, such as guar gum. The fillers take up valuable nutrition space that could be better used to provide antioxidants or extra protein.

    Conclusion

    The Abound cat food brand is an affordable option that rivals the higher-end pet shop brands. It’s touted as a natural food brand, which is valid for the most part, even if it includes ingredients that aren’t necessarily a natural part of a cat’s diet. With dry and wet food and various treats available, it would be tough for cats to get bored with their diet when eating Abound.

    However, it isn’t a brand that stands out from the crowd regarding quality. Many other brands on the market feature the same, if not better, ingredients.
